What is Cognitive Testing?
Cognitive testing involves a series of assessments designed to evaluate various aspects of cognitive functioning, including memory, attention, problem-solving skills, language abilities, and executive function. These tests are essential in identifying cognitive decline, which can be a natural part of aging or an indicator of more serious conditions such as dementia or Alzheimer’s disease.
Types of Cognitive Testing
Several types of cognitive tests are used to provide a comprehensive assessment:
- Memory Tests: These tests measure both short-term and long-term memory. They help identify memory loss patterns and determine whether the issues are related to normal aging or more serious conditions.
- Attention and Concentration Tests: These assessments evaluate an individual’s ability to focus and maintain attention over time, which can be impacted by aging.
- Language Tests: Language skills, including naming, fluency, and comprehension, are assessed to detect any deterioration in verbal abilities.
- Executive Function Tests: These tests measure planning, problem-solving, and organizational skills, which are crucial for daily living and can decline with age.
